Zone Of Proximal Development

The Zone of Proximal Development is a theory in educational psychology that describes the difference between what a learner can achieve independently and what they can achieve with guidance and encouragement from a skilled partner.

Cognitive Task

An activity designed to assess or engage mental processes such as memory, attention, problem-solving, and decision-making.

Sensorimotor

The developmental stage in infants and toddlers, as identified by Piaget, where they learn to manipulate and explore their environment using their senses and motor abilities.

Preoperational Thought

A stage in cognitive development, as described by Piaget, where children ages 2 to 7 engage in symbolic play and struggle with logic and taking the perspective of others.
